RIM doubles profits from BlackBerry sales

Up 100% compared to 2006

NEWS: 24 December 2007 12:00 GMT by Stuart Miles

BlackBerry maker Research In Motion has doubled its profits in the last quarter following strong demand for its smartphones from consumers and businesses alike.

Revenue for the third quarter of fiscal 2008 was $1.67 billion, up 22% from $1.37 billion in the previous quarter and up 100% from $835.1 million in the same quarter of last year.

The revenue breakdown for the quarter was approximately 80% for devices, 14% for service, 4% for software and 2% for other revenue.

Approximately 1.65 million BlackBerry subscriber accounts were added in the quarter and over 3.9 million devices were shipped according to the manufacturer.

The results mean that there are now 12m BlackBerry subscribers around the world.

RIM has said that it expects revenue for its fourth quarter of fiscal 2008 ending March 1, 2008 is expected to be in the range of $1.80-$1.87 billion.

RIMM shares were up 10% on the news.
